Understanding the MKD to ADA Conversion
The conversion from Macedonian Denar to Cardano is not just a simple numerical exchange; it reflects the broader market dynamics that influence both assets. The Macedonian Denar is the official currency of North Macedonia, a country with a developing economy, while Cardano is one of the top cryptocurrencies by market capitalization, known for its research-driven approach and proof-of-stake consensus mechanism.
When you convert 10 MKD to ADA, you are essentially measuring the purchasing power of the Denar against a decentralized digital asset. This rate is determined by the global supply and demand for ADA, the relative strength of the Denar, and the overall sentiment in the crypto market. Navigating Crypto Conversions Safely
When converting fiat to crypto, it's crucial to use reputable exchanges like Bybit that offer transparent pricing and secure transactions. Always double-check the conversion rate, and be aware of any fees that may apply. The rate you see on news aggregators like Google News is often for informational purposes and may not reflect the exact rate you will get on the exchange.
Additionally, consider the timing of your transaction. Cryptocurrency markets are open 24/7, and prices can be highly volatile. If you're looking to convert a specific amount, like 10 MKD to ADA, you might want to set a target rate or use limit orders to ensure you get a price you're comfortable with.
Finally, always secure your ADA in a reliable wallet. While exchanges are convenient for trading, they are not the safest place to store large amounts of cryptocurrency for the long term. Use hardware wallets or reputable software wallets to keep your assets safe from potential hacks or exchange failures.
